The journey begins with choosing the right tree and understanding its compatibility with the new location. Various factors, such as soil quality, sunlight, drainage, and space availability, must align with the needs of the tree species. The more closely these factors match, the better a tree will adapt and thrive. Opting for native species can be advantageous, as they are more likely to transition smoothly and are generally more resilient to local pests and diseases.
Once the tree is selected, preparing it for the move is crucial. This preparation often involves root pruning, which helps in developing a compact root system concentrated around the root ball. Ideally, this should be done several months before the actual move to give the tree time to adjust. The season also plays a significant role in transplant success. Typically, transplanting during the tree's dormant period—late fall or early spring—is recommended to minimize stress and encourage root establishment.
On the day of the move, the tree is carefully excavated. Special attention is given to preserving the root ball, as a damaged root system can severely impact a tree's chance of survival. Once transplanted, the tree's aftercare is critical to its long-term health. Watering schedules must be meticulously followed, particularly in the first few months after the transplant, as the tree establishes itself in the new location. Overwatering or underwatering can both be detrimental, so monitoring soil moisture is essential. Mulching around the base can help retain moisture and regulate soil temperature, further aiding the tree as it acclimates.
Additionally, ongoing monitoring for signs of stress is vital. Leaf wilt, yellowing, or unusual shedding can indicate that the tree is struggling. Addressing these issues promptly can prevent long-term damage. Fertilizing is generally discouraged immediately after transplanting since it can shock the tree's systems; instead, focus on soil amendments that boost natural microbial activity and improve nutrient availability.
